17 January 2011 - Yoga with Liezel

This morning I got a chance to experience Yoga first hand with Yogini Kate Ball. Someone who practices yoga or follows the yoga philosophy to a high level of attainment is called a yogi or yogini.
Here are some of the benefits of Yoga that Kate shared with me:
Physiological Benefits of Yoga
│Stable autonomic nervous system equilibrium
│Blood Pressure decreases
│Breath-holding time increases
│Joint range of motion increase
│Grip strength increases
│Eye-hand coordination improves
Psychological Benefits of Yoga
│Somatic and kinesthetic awareness increase
│Mood improves and subjective well-being increases
│Self-acceptance and self-actualization increase
│Social adjustment increases
│Anxiety and Depression decrease
Biochemical Benefits of Yoga
│Glucose decreases
│Sodium decreases
│Total cholesterol decreases
│Triglycerides decrease
│Cholinesterase increases

7 December 2010 - The Vital Run

The Vital Run
On Saturday the 4th of December, I enjoyed my first ever 10km race in the Western Cape, at The Vita Run, which was a race arranged by Vital Health Foods, in association with Run/Walk for Life, and many raised from entries were in aid of the PATCH Helderberg Child Abuse Centre.. The race took place at the scenic Lourensford Wine Estate in Somerset West.
It was an unforgettable morning at the foot of the Helderberg Mountain for not only the runners, but families and friends who were serious about looking after their health. I entered for the 10km run, not thinking I’d be brave enough for the 21km, as I heard that the 21 km will pose a challenge to gutsy top runners on the first 3 km, but the apparent scenic route would be a reward, as runners could see panoramic views of the Helderberg basin and Hottentots Holland Mountain ranges.
So off I went to join the start of the 10 km route, which I heard was scenic and not too hilly. Being the social runner, I started in the front but soon ended up near the back as I was chatting away to everyone who ran past. It’s always nice to hear the stories of why people run or how they got into running.
What I enjoyed about this run, there was no cut off time, so even for the slowest runner or walker; you could take your time and enjoy your day out in nature.

1 December 2010 - The Cycle Tour Trust

The Sporty Adventures of Liezel
So what do you do when you get a call from The Cycle Tour Trust asking if you would be keen to cycle in the Double Century in Swellendam? Any sane person would’ve said no immediately, but not me, I just heard cycle and I said Yes, without even asking the distance. Only after I had confirmed that I would take part, did I hear that it is a 202km cycle race, all to be done on one day.
It was at this point that I started to backtrack and try every excuse in the book to get out of this crazy race, but unfortunately for me, David Bellairs from The Cycle Tour Trust wouldn’t take no for an answer.
So last Friday I packed in my bike and headed off to Swellendam which was to be the start of this crazy day. I was to head out in the first team of the day which is also the slowest team with the stronger riders heading out later in the day. Of course all these super fast cyclists eventually caught up with us along the way as we slowly climbed every hill at about 11km an hour. That also explains why I never made the cut off time for the race. But one thing I can say I learnt from this long day in the saddle and the fantastic team I rode with is that anything is possible. Next year I will be back and with the same team and finish on time
At the end of this long day in the saddle, I remember the quote by Arthur Ashe: “Success is a journey, not a destination, the doing is often more important than the outcome”

I thought I'd also share some interesting facts about Christmas Trees.
Christmas Tree Facts:
- Christmas trees have been sold commercially in the United States since about 1850.
- Recycled trees have been used to make sand and soil erosion barriers and been placed in ponds for fish shelter.
- Christmas trees take an average of 7-10 years to mature.
- Christmas trees remove dust and pollen from the air.
- 73 million new Christmas trees will be planted this year.
- You should not burn your Christmas tree in the fireplace; it can contribute to creosote build up.
- An acre of Christmas trees provides for the daily oxygen requirements of 18 people.
- 2-3 seedlings are planted for every harvested Christmas tree. In 2004 sixty million Christmas tree seedlings were planted by Christmas tree farmers.
- 30-35 million Real Christmas Trees are sold in the U.S. every year
